Supports the National Curriculum
Science, Year 1, Animals, including Humans
Identify, name, draw and label the basic parts of the human body and say which part of the body is associated with each sense.
Science, Year 3, Animals, including Humans
Identify that humans and some other animals have skeletons and muscles for support, protection and movement.
